Sodium dihydrogen phosphate, usually referred to as monosodium phosphate, refers to an essential chemical compound. Comprising sodium, phosphorous, and hydrogen elements, it plays a pivotal role in the realms of food, agriculture, and chemistry. Recognized for its buffering capacity, this compound is frequently employed as a food additive to regulate acidity and enhance the shelf life of products. Moreover, it finds utility in fertilizers, acting as a phosphorous source that enriches soil nutrient content. Its multifaceted attributes have positioned sodium dihydrogen phosphate as an indispensable component in both industrial and everyday contexts.

It is witnessing consequential market drivers and trends. The elevating demand for processed foods and beverages, especially in emerging economies, is boosting the market as sodium dihydrogen phosphate is utilized as a food additive for its emulsifying and buffering properties. Moreover, its application as a pH regulator and nutrient supplement in the pharmaceutical industry is propelling its demand. Environmental concerns and a shift towards eco-friendly alternatives are encouraging manufacturers to explore sustainable production methods and sources of sodium dihydrogen phosphate. Additionally, the inflating awareness of the importance of water treatment in various industries is driving the demand for this compound as it serves as a corrosion inhibitor and scale suppressor in water treatment processes. To stay competitive, market players are focusing on research and development to enhance product quality and explore new applications. Overall, the market for sodium dihydrogen phosphate is evolving with a blend of consumer demands, regulatory changes, and technological advancements, shaping its trajectory in diverse industries.
